Chopped is a televised cooking competition in which four professional chefs make appetizers, entrees, and desserts using ingredients from three distinct "mystery baskets," each designed to throw the chefs off course. Four competitors have the chance to cook three courses, with a panel of judges eliminating one contestant after each course.
